Parque Reparto Metropolitano
About
Parque Reparto Metropolitano is San Juan's sprawling green oasis where families can escape the urban hustle for outdoor adventures. This massive park offers everything from shaded walking trails and open fields perfect for running wild to sports facilities and picnic areas where families can spend an entire day enjoying the tropical climate and natural beauty.

Pro Tips
- 1.Bring sunscreen and reapply frequently as tropical sun is strong even on cloudy days, and shade can be limited in some areas
- 2.Pack a picnic and plenty of water since food vendors may not always be available within the park
- 3.Visit early morning (7-9am) for cooler temperatures and to see locals exercising, or late afternoon (4-6pm) to avoid midday heat
- 4.Bring sports equipment like soccer balls, frisbees, or bikes to take advantage of the open spaces and facilities
- 5.The park is family-oriented and very safe during daylight hours, but plan to leave before dark
Best Time to Visit
Early morning (7-9am) or late afternoon (4-6pm) on weekdays to avoid the intense midday heat and weekend crowds. The cooler months from December to April offer the most comfortable weather for extended outdoor play.
What to Know
Admission is completely free, making this an excellent budget-friendly option for families. Street parking is available around the park perimeter, and while there are no on-site food vendors, you can bring your own picnic supplies.
Seasonal Notes
Open year-round. The dry season from December through April offers the most pleasant weather, while May through November can be hot and humid with afternoon rain showers. Bring rain gear during wet season and check weather before heading out.
